What actions should your company take to prevent or mitigate human rights impacts?
In collaboration with Shift and UN Human Rights, UN Global Compact is organizing a three-part Academy Deep Dive Series designed to help UN Global Compact Participants develop an actionable plan to identify, prevent, mitigate and account for their human rights impacts.
The second session of the series takes place on 11 May. It will help participants figure out what actions they should take to prevent or mitigate impacts of their company.
